Hydrangea arborescens (Wild Hydrangea) is quite an attractive and fast-growing shrub.  Its pleasant mound shape makes it exquisite for foundation plantings and shade tree underplantings.  Many cultivars are developed from this species that have many more sterile flowers which are showier, however, they are not as beneficial for our local ecology.  Hydrangea arborescens (Wild Hydrangea) prefers dappled sunlight to light shade and consistently moist conditions.  Protection from wind and direct sun is a must for this species.
